The installation of sliding windows normally follows an organized approach. While the particular techniques can differ, the process outlined listed below acts as a general guideline.
Step 1: Measure the Opening
Precise measurements are crucial. Using the measuring tape, measure the width and height of the existing window frame. Deduct 1/4 inch from each measurement to represent expansion and fit.
Step 2: Prepare the OpeningRemove Old Window: Carefully take off the old window and clean the opening. Check for Damage: Check for rot or damage around the frame and replace any jeopardized wood.Step 3: Install the Sill
The sill serves as the base for your sliding window. Install a water resistant flashing tape to the bottom of the opening to ensure it remains totally free from water damage.
Step 4: Set the Window FramePosition the Frame: Place the sliding window frame into the opening. Look for Level: Use a level to ensure that the window is straight. Change appropriately by including shims if needed.Step 5: Secure the Frame
Using screws, fasten the window frame to the sides of the opening. Make sure to follow the maker's guidelines for screw placement.
Step 6: Install the Sashes
Slide the sashes into the tracks offered in the frame. Ensure they move efficiently which the locking system works properly.
Action 7: Weatherproofing
Apply insulation foam around the border to improve energy effectiveness. Seal the edges with a water resistant sealant to prevent air leaks.
Step 8: Finishing Touches
Lastly, include interior and exterior trim as required to conceal spaces. Paint or stain the trim to match the existing decoration.

Q: How long does it take to set up a sliding window?A: Depending on your experience level, installing a sliding window can take anywhere from 2 to 5 hours. Q: Can I install sliding Authentic Sash Windows in winter?A: Yes, however bemindful that cold temperatures can impact materials
like sealant. Guarantee you select the right products for your environment. Q: What is the average cost of sliding window installation?A: The expense can differ commonly based upon window size and quality, however normally, you can expect to pay between 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window, including labor. Q: How do I understand if my windows need replacing?A: Signs consist of drafts, condensation in between panes, difficulty opening or closing, and decomposing frames.

Q: Do sliding windows offer great insulation?A: Yes
, provided they are installed properly and are of high quality, sliding windows can use good insulation.
